परिभाषा
संज्ञा.- acidosis resulting from reduced gas exchange in the lungs (as in emphysema or pneumonia); excess carbon dioxide combines with water to form carbonic acid which increases the acidity of the blood
पर्याय: carbon dioxide acidosis
